About Republic Bank & Trust Company
Republic Bank & Trust Company is a mid-sized institution, headquartered in Louisville, Kentucky. Deposits are insured by the FDIC up to $250,000 per depositor, per ownership category. The figures on this page come from the institution's own regulatory filing dated 2026-09-16, not from marketing material.
This bank reports $7.1 billion in total assets, $5.6 billion in deposits and 48 locations in 6 states.

A short checklist before you act
None of this needs a spreadsheet. It needs the discipline of checking the same handful of things every time, whether you are opening a savings, checking or CD account for the first time or the fifth.
- Confirm the rate you were quoted is the standard rate, not a promotional tier that resets after a few months.
- Check the minimum balance and the monthly maintenance fee, which can quietly outweigh the interest earned.
- Check the fee schedule and the fine print, not the headline rate — that is where the real cost usually hides.
- Ask what the number looks like in a bad year, not an average one, and make sure the plan still holds.
- Write down the monthly number you can genuinely cover, not the maximum a lender or admissions office says you qualify for.
- Compare at least three offers. Pricing on the same product varies more between providers than most people expect, and the gap is yours to keep.
